COVID-19 Follow-up Committee Holds 94th Meeting
Published in Saudi Press Agency on 26 - 05 - 2020

Under the chairmanship of Health Minister Dr. Tawfiq bin Fawzan Al-Rabiah, the COVID-19 Follow-up Committee held its 94th meeting today, in the presence of the members of the Committee representing a number of the relevant governmental entities.
During the meeting, all relevant COVID-19 updates and reports were reviewed. The committee discussed the epidemiological situation globally, as well as the cases reported locally. All precautionary measures carried out at the points of entry into the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ia will continue in full and will be further enhanced, the committee stressed.
Following the meeting, Assistant Minister of Health Dr. Mohammed Al-Abdulaali who is also Spokesperson of the Health Ministry said in a press conference that the total number of confirmed COVID-19 cases worldwide is 5512055 cases, of which 2247952 cases have been cured to date. The COVID-19 death toll has jumped to 346612.
Dr. Al-Abdulaali said that 1931 new COVID-19 cases were reported today in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ia, adding that the new cases were reported in Riyadh (789), Jeddah (327), Hufof (166), Dammam (143), Makkah (120), Buraidah (97), Jubail (37), Qattif (31), Khobar (26), Tabuk (17), Taif (13), Madinah (12), Baish (10), Dhahran (10), Al-Sehen (9), Al-Kharj (9), Manfath Al-Hodaithah (7), Al-Jafr (6), Unaizah (5), Arar (5), Tameer (5), Khamis Mushait (4), Hail (4), Khulais (4), Huraymla (4), Qulwa (4), Al-Nemas (3), Mahayel Asir (3), Safwa (3), Najran (3), Sharorah (3), Al-Hada (3), Al-Majma'a (3), Al-Sulayyil (3), Ramah (3), Sakaka (2), Abha (2), Billasmar (2), Sabt Al-Alayah (2), Wadi Al-Dawasir (2), Umluj (2), and one case in each of Baljurashi, Al-Makhwah, Arras, Al-Badaea, Al-Bukeriah, Al-Qurayat, Al-Qunfuthah, Dhalm, Misan, Um edoum, Ahad Rufaidah, Bqeeq, Ras Tanura, Al-Aydabi, Fayfa, Samtah, Ahad Al-Masarhah, Adhum, Al-Laith, Tarif, Al-Dawadmi, Al-Mazahmiah, Duhrma, Hottat bani Tamim, Thadiq, Al-Mahani, Dheba and Ghazalah.
He said that the total cases tested positive for COVID-19 in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ia is 76726 cases, of which 27865 cases are active cases receiving medical care, and their health condition is mostly stable; with the exception of 397 critical cases, adding that the number of the new recoveries is 2782, bringing the total number of recoveries to 48450.
He also pointed out that the cases confirmed today represent 55% for non-Saudis and 45% for Saudi nationals, adding that the number of the new deaths is 12, bringing the total death toll to 411.
With regard to the tests at the laboratories, Dr. Al-Abdulaali disclosed that 16664 new tests are conducted, bringing the total number of the tests to 738743 until now.
He called on whoever has symptoms or would like to check-up, to use the self-assessment service in MAWID application, inquire or consult the Health Center (937) around the clock, or inquire or consult through WhatsApp number 920005937.
